Transaction 814257fe74d72d40151aab611df21a5bb72c24a944a4414e64a26cbd708fa4a6
1 Input
2 Outputs
- 814257fe74d72d40151aab611df21a5bb72c24a944a4414e64a26cbd708fa4a6:0
- 814257fe74d72d40151aab611df21a5bb72c24a944a4414e64a26cbd708fa4a6:1
value 6576976
address 19GwmXBHz7j4WhQGruLWyXNz8pW4g6wQfd
value 13020000
address 3KQKXFcF5346detG8sf5TwJ1L4mxSRpnto